Solemyoidea is a superfamily of mussels. There are 35 species of Solemyoidea, in 2 genera and 1 family. This superfamily has been around since the ordovician period. It includes groups like Awning Clam. Dead Solemyoidea form shallow marine sediments. They have sexual reproduction. They are facultatively mobile animals.
